WebThe calculator below calculates Earth radius at a given latitude. In fact, of course, it calculates the radius of WGS 84 reference ellipsoid at a given latitude, and if you want some theory recap, you can find it below the calculator. WebFeb 9, 2024 · r, or the circle's radius, is the length of a line that joins the center point with any point lying on the circle. You can find it with the following formulas: If you know the diameter of the circle: r = d / 2. If diameter and area are unknown: r = c / 2π. If diameter and circumference are unknown: r = √ (a / π)
